Security readout for executives and security teams
SQLite 3.30.1 had a bug in ZIP archive update handling: a NULL pathname could be mishandled. The source record gives no CVSS score and no active exploitation evidence. Business urgency depends on whether products expose SQLite's ZIP-file extension to untrusted ZIP archive operations. Exposure is most likely where SQLite 3.30.1 or vendor-packaged SQLite builds include and use the zipfile extension with ZIP archives that may be attacker-controlled. Embedded products may inherit exposure through bundled SQLite, as reflected by NetApp, Oracle, Siemens, and Linux distribution advisories. Prioritize according to asset exposure, not headline severity. There is no supplied CVSS score or active exploitation evidence, but SQLite's embedded footprint makes missed exposure plausible. Patch through normal vendor channels, accelerating where untrusted ZIP handling is reachable. Mitigation focus: Identify systems and products using SQLite 3.30.1 or affected vendor packages.; Apply vendor-provided SQLite security updates from the relevant platform advisory.; Review embedded appliances and third-party products that bundle SQLite..
